2017-06-16 11 views
0

私の完全なテスト名がSuite 01.test 01.testであるとします。ロボットタグの-tオプションをどのように渡しますか?私は引用符を入れることを試みたが、それは常にそれが役に立たなかった01.testRobotframework Inlcudeに空白が含まれているテスト

+1

引用符で囲んでみてください。 –

答えて

1

ロボットは名前のスペースとアンダースコアを無視するだけでなく、大文字と小文字を無視する。

pybot --test Suite01.Test01 ... 
pybot --test Suite_01.Test_01 ... 
pybot --test suite_01.test01 ... 
pybot --test suite01.Test_01 ... 

そして、あなたは正確な名前を使用することを好む場合はもちろん、あなたがコマンドラインで引用符を使用することができます:すべてのことビーイング

$ pybot --test "Suite 01.Test 01" ... 

をので、例えば、以下はすべて同じです数十年にわたる私の経験では、名前にスペースを含むファイルを作成することはお勧めできません。すべてのOSで許可されていますが、コマンドラインでこれらのファイルを扱うことは困難です。あなたは、名前にスペースを含むファイルを許可するという決定を再検討したいかもしれません。